The U.S. Regulatory Landscape and Copper Decommissioning

Decommissioning copper networks involves navigating a complex regulatory environment, which has a substantial impact on the liquidation and value of these assets. The Federal Communications Commission (FCC) has been steering the transition from legacy copper networks to more advanced technology through various rulings. One of the landmark rulings is the 2015 Technology Transitions Order, which allows carriers such as AT&T to retire copper assets under certain conditions.

This regulatory stance has opened the door for AT&T to consider the monetization of outdated copper assets. Given the reduced demand for copper wiring as telecommunications evolve toward fiber-optic and wireless systems, the value of these assets has been influenced. As a result, the company has the potential to see favorable financial outcomes from the divestiture of its redundant copper infrastructure. The optimal liquidation strategy must adhere to FCC guidelines ensuring that customers are not adversely affected during the transition, and that any changes in service are communicated effectively and in a timely manner.

Regulations also require AT&T to provide competitors access to certain parts of its network, a legacy of the Telecommunications Act of 1996 aimed at maintaining competition. The current direction of regulatory policies may enable AT&T to wind down these obligations as it shifts towards newer technologies. Fulfilling these regulatory conditions signals to both markets and policymakers that AT&T is aligned with the trend towards next-generation networks, potentially boosting its bargaining position when selling or repurposing its copper assets.

The Evolution of Technology Infrastructure

Technology infrastructure has undergone a remarkable metamorphosis, transitioning from the traditional copper wires that once formed the backbone of telecommunication systems to materials that facilitate increased speed and reliability. With the advent of innovative materials, network capabilities have expanded exponentially.

Fiber optics is a shining example of technological progress, offering significant advantages over its copper predecessors. Consisting of tiny glass or plastic strands that transmit data via light waves, fiber optics achieves superior bandwidth and signal integrity over much longer distances than copper cables. This enhancement means that data can travel faster and with less loss, ushering in a new era of internet speed and connectivity.

Simultaneously, wireless technology has not remained static. Advances in wireless communication have brought forth the ability to transmit large amounts of data through the air via radio waves. These strides culminate in the latest 5G networks. Significantly faster and more reliable than the previous generations, 5G technology is capable of supporting massive data demands of today and tomorrow, poised to power the burgeoning Internet of Things, smart cities, and a host of other futuristic applications.
